Dear Listmates.  I finally have information about Fenway Park. I was 
never able to reach Kevin Haggarty. A kindly receptionist put me in 
touch with the warehouse. A young man there read the labels to me.  I 
asked about hamburgers, hot dogs and nachos.  The hot dogs and nachos 
look ok.  The hamburgers are NOT. The second ingredient is wheat flour!  
I did not ask about rotissarie chicken. It is not something my son would 
want, neigher is clam chowder.   Other items listed in the concession 
guide such as candy, ice cream, cracker jacks and soda I did not ask 
about. We have had plenty of experience with those.  So tomorrow my son 
will be having a hot dog without a bun. Possibly nachos if the stand 
looks clean enough.  I think he will have a good time any way.  The site
